Definition

Noun: 1. A savory dish, typically of Filipino origin, consisting of meat (commonly chicken or pork), seafood, or vegetables that are marinated and then stewed in a mixture of vinegar, soy sauce, garlic, bay leaves, and black peppercorns. It is traditionally served with rice.

Usage
  • Adobo is considered a national dish of the Philippines.
  • The word is used as a mass noun (uncountable) when referring to the dish in general or a portion of it, and as a countable noun when referring to distinct types or servings.
    • "I cooked adobo for dinner." (mass noun)
    • "The restaurant offers three different adobos: chicken, pork, and squid." (countable noun)

Advanced Usage
  • The term can be used attributively (like an adjective) to describe other dishes or components prepared in the adobo style.
    • "They served adobo wings as an appetizer."
    • "I love the adobo flavor in these potato chips."
Variants and Related Words
  • Adobong (Tagalog): The Tagalog word often used in compound names for the dish, such as (chicken adobo) or (pork adobo).
  • Adobada (Spanish): A related but distinct Mexican dish involving marinated and grilled meat, often pork.
Synonyms
  • Stew: A general term for a dish of meat and vegetables cooked slowly in liquid. (Note: This is a broader, less specific synonym.)
  • Braise: A cooking method similar to that used for adobo, involving browning and then simmering in a covered pot.
Notes on Different Meanings
  • In Spanish, refers broadly to a marinade, seasoning, or pickling sauce. The Filipino dish derives its name from this Spanish term due to the historical influence of Spanish cuisine in the Philippines, but it has evolved into a uniquely Filipino preparation.
